This was initially created in Spring 2016 by me (Noah Patullo), as a final project for CS142 Advanced Web Design at UVM taught by Bob Erickson
UVM Bikes is a student club that operates a bike shop for UVM students. We don't charge for labor & are here to help people learn to fix their own bikes too. I was a member of the club and also did web design so I thought it would be a good source for a project.

A slideshow is implemented on all pages using Galleria
The images are all in the same folder images/slideshow/1homepage/
and named image001.jpg, image003.jpg, image003.jpg
etc. This allow PHP to simply count the number of files in a folder, then printe out the appropriate image tags for the exact number of images
This means I can add or subtract images to the folder and won't need to update the html. (As long as the images are named correctly)
- The Galleria slideshow occasionaly doesn't work. It has a height specified in CSS, but sometimes it thinks the containing box is 0px tall & won't load. I added an empty paragraph with " " before the galleria div to fix this & it seems to work.
